What is PPC?
PPC stands for Pay-Per-Click, which is an online advertising model that allows you to display ads on search engines and other platforms. Whenever someone clicks on your ad, you pay a small fee. Think of it as putting up a billboard on a busy highway—every time someone sees it and wants to know more, you pay a little bit.

How PPC Benefits Your Dental Practice
-
More Calls and Appointments: When your dental practice appears at the top of Google’s search results through PPC ads, you increase the chances of receiving phone calls. For example, if someone types “dentist near me” and your ad shows up, there’s a good chance they’ll click it, call your office, and schedule an appointment.
-
Targeted Advertising: With PPC, you can decide who sees your ads. For instance, you can target your ads to specific neighborhoods in Bradenton, or even to locals searching for pediatric or cosmetic dentistry. This ensures your services reach the right audience.
-
Measurable Results: Unlike traditional advertising methods, PPC allows you to see exactly how many clicks your ads receive, how many customers convert, and what your return on investment (ROI) is.
-
Quick Results: Once your PPC campaign is live, your ads can start appearing on search engines almost immediately. This quick visibility can work wonders for bringing new patients into your practice.
-
Affordable for Small Businesses: You can control your PPC budget. Start with a small amount and gradually increase it as you see results. You won’t need to break the bank to get noticeable results.

FAQs about PPC for Dental Practices
Q1: How much should I spend on PPC advertising?
A: Your PPC budget can vary based on your goals and the competitiveness of the dental industry in your area. It’s wise to start with a manageable amount, like $200–$500 a month, and adjust based on the results you see.
Q2: How do I know if PPC is working for my dental practice?
A: You can track the number of calls received from your ads, website visits, and even appointments made. This will give you tangible data to measure success.
Q3: Can I create my own PPC ads?
A: Yes, you can create your own ads using platforms like Google ads, but consider seeking professional help for the best results. A PPC expert can manage your campaigns and optimize them for better performance.
Q4: How quickly can I expect results from PPC?
A: Many businesses begin to see results within a few days of launching a PPC campaign. The key is to continually monitor and adjust your ads for optimal performance.
Q5: Will my competitors see my PPC ads?
A: Yes, if they search for the same keywords, your competitors may see your ads. However, this is standard in the industry, and the focus should be on attracting potential patients rather than worrying about competition.
